Speaker:   Matthew DuPuy

Last March, Matt was part of a team of seven young men who participated in an annual 150 mile relay race from the Dead Sea to the Red Sea. After the race, the bunch of them toured through Jordan and Lebanon.   They visited the temple at Petra, the tombs of Palmyra,  a Palestinian Refugee camp and parts of  Beirut.

After that, Matt and Jon toured Syria.  From Syria, they traveled to Turkey and then to northern Iraq.   Matt and Jon travelled to some remote villages in northern Iraq.  One of their hosts was a Kurdish army officer who drove them up to an outpost on the lower slopes of Cheekha Dar, part of the Zagros mountain range.   Cheekha Dar is the highest mountain in Iraq at 11,847 feet.  Matt and Jonathan climbed up through rock and snow fields to the summit of Cheekha Dar.   They were cited this year as becoming the first westerners to summit the mountain in the winter time.

Matt will be showing pictures of this March 2011 trip to the Middle East.

United Methodist Men's Lazy W Retreat

The Lazy W Retreat is held on a weekend in March each year at beautiful Camp Lazy W which is off the Ortega Highway some 10 miles east of San Juan Capistrano. Each retreat has a Christian based theme that is interwoven throughout the weekend in presentations, Bible study, hymn singing and the Sunday Morning Worship Service. The event also features a work project designed to be helpful to the camp manager, delicious home cooked food and free time activities such as hiking, horseshoes and ping pong.
